Countless
repeating guns have been designed. Many are great fun, but virtually all
have been reasonably inaccurate, best suited for informal plinking at cans
and such. Now there is the Beeman/Feinwerkbau C56P, a 5 shot
semi-automatic that has single hole accuracy.
The C56P fires .177 caliber pellets from a rapid fire 5 shot magazine
using a new jolt-free mechanism. The airgun comes complete with one five
shot magazine; spares are available. In the rapid fire mode the clip is
advanced each time the trigger is pulled - you can put all five shots
through the bull's eye as fast as you can pull the trigger!
The four sets of three lateral openings allow four sets of tiny
vents to prevent muzzle jump with a truly negligible loss of velocity. The
built-in muzzle brake reduces both the already low recoil and pellet
disturbance at the muzzle. The C56P now accepts the same muzzle weights as
the P34, they come as a pair weighing 30 grams each (item 7131).
With the new horizontal tank and regulator shooters can expect to
get around 200 shots from a cylinder before refilling is required. All
cylinders now come equipped with a gauge for checking pressure
"at-a-glance". The excellent, widely adjustable,
anatomical grip, now supplied by Morini, is considered by many as
the most comfortable, steadiest grip ever produced.
The trigger is vintage Feinwerkbau perfection, adjustable in multiple
ways, and crisp to the touch. For competition or fun, the C56P is an air
pistol that all airgun aficionados should add to their collection. |

This model is the single stroke pneumatic entry in the line of Beeman/Feinwerkbau air pistols. The unique aspect of the gun is that the new 103 incorporates a detachable single lever, for reduced firing weight and improved balance.
Swinging the cocking lever forward opens the loading gate. The pellet is loaded into the bore, and with the loading gate in the open position the line of sight is blocked. This aids the shooter in focusing on the task at hand and eliminates lost shots by not loading a pellet during the intense concentration of a match.
The 103 comes with a muzzle brake fitted as standard, which diverts air flow from the pellet flight, for improved follow through, and target placement.
As is standard with the Feinwerkbau airguns, the wonderfully sensitive trigger is near perfection. The unit is completely adjustable in almost every conceivable way, and there is even a dry-fire mechanism to allow sight control and trigger practice. The grip, available for right and left handed shooters, is also adjustable, and seems to fit the hand like a glove.

The Beeman HW70A air pistol represents more than just value for the money, it represents a good investment in the future. This airgun will provide many hours of shooting fun for the entire family for years to come.
This simple spring piston airgun is cocked just like the break barrel air rifles. The single cocking stroke will generate up to 440 fps making this a powerful airgun, despite its moderate size and light weight. These aspects alone make the HW70A the perfect choice for shooters small and large to take along on an outing.
Considered a very attractive air pistol, the fine barrel and receiver bear an extremely durable dark blue-black epoxy finish with an unusually high luster. The stock is molded in a deep brown with a durable scratch resistant texture. There is even a thumb shelf in the grip for both right and left-handed shooters making this an ambidextrous design.
For an economy gun, the HW70A has one of the finest triggers available. The two stage unit pulls back evenly and consistently to a stop, at which point the shooter knows just the slightest bit more pressure will set off the unit. A wide, beautifully grooved trigger blade is machined from aluminum, and adds to the control of the unit. The pistol now includes an automatic safety on the left side; it is engaged each time the gun is cocked, and can easily be disengaged (or re-engaged) with the thumb.
The accuracy is very good for a sporting pistol thanks to the full six inch barrel with the fine 12 groove rifling. The rear sight is adjustable for windage and elevation, and the hooded post front sight allows for quick centering on the target. The gentle firing behavior of the HW70 is another benefit of the gun. The gun shoots very smoothly, with little vibration, and just enough recoil to get a "sense of shooting."
Attractive and fun to shoot, the HW70 air pistol would make an excellent addition to any gun collection. |

The P1 is a unique combination of Beeman airgun experience and design with the assistance of our German partners engineering and manufacturing skills. The result is a blend of two cultures to make one of the most popular adult air pistols ever produced.
A major objective of the P1 design was to give it an "American" flavor, and it seemed nothing but the famous Colt .45 Auto could come closer to being recognized around the world as one of America's finest. Although the P1 is not a replica, many of the design features between the two guns are similar as virtually all shooters hold the .45 in the highest regard.
This spring piston gun is cocked by a single stroke. The "hammer" on the back is really the catch for the cocking lever. Release the "hammer" and the top cocks over the gun until it locks into place. The pellet is loaded directly into the barrel and the unit then snaps back down, ready to fire. Accuracy is increased as the sights move with the entire cocking arm and barrel, never changing position. A scope can even be mounted on the 11mm dovetail grooves along the top of the action.
At only 11 inches in length, the small size of the pistol is remarkable considering the velocity. To get the optimum power a full size compression tube must be installed, and this was accomplished by the overhead cocking design of the gun. Furthering the concept, the .177 caliber version of the piston has a dual power mode - cocking the gun to the first "lock point" will result in "low" power, around 380 fps which is still better than many other air pistols. Cocking the gun a bit further will click into the "high" power position for a full 600 fps making the P1 one of the most powerful spring piston airguns ever made! The full compression tube also results in a nicely balanced pistol as it runs the full length of the gun.
The two stage trigger is adjustable from the 28 ounce factory setting. The wide trigger blade has a serrated surface that makes the trigger pull feel extra light and gives a smooth, controlled feel to the unit. The incredible trigger is constantly one of the things that people comment on being one of the best features of the gun.
Finally, we carefully and deliberately designed the dimensions of the grip and trigger area so that it is possible to fit any .45 Auto grips on the P1. Shooters can thus maintain the feel of their firearm while training inexpensively with the P1. The rearward expanding mainspring adds to the effectiveness as a firearm trainer as the modest recoil goes into the hand, like a firearm. Shooters can be confident this air pistol will present a reliable measure of their marksmanship skills while training with a P1.
The Beeman P1 air pistol is available in .177 caliber, or the popular .20 caliber. The larger .20 caliber pellets are much less sensitive to wind drift (even indoor convection currents) and provide a greater impact than .177 caliber. |

When you see and hold the Beeman P3, you know that you have a serious pistol in hand. Its design, and even its weight and heft, gives a solid feeling of the very best in the world's semi-automatic handguns: the looks and feel of guns which are not only the arms of the latest James Bond 007 movie, but also the choice of the top military and police forces of the world. The similarity of the P3 to a fine firearm is astonishing: it even sports a simulated decocking lever, magazine release button, trigger guard shaped for two handed firing, and cartridge ejection port and the muzzle opening is an awesome 9 mm (.38) caliber! A very solid rail is built into the top frame.
The Beeman P3 is the first quality air pistol to join the ranks of the now elite polymer firearm pistols now being produced in Europe and America. That is, it is a marriage of the finest ordinance steel critical parts wrapped in super strong, fiber-reinforced, space age polymers like the famous Glock and latest Walther firearm pistols. The very reasonable price of this gun represents a manufacturing shift to a more efficient, better method of construction, rather than any reduction of quality. This pistol is simply in a much higher league than the lower grade plastic and/or pot metal air pistols, even ones of higher price that depend on gadgetry features, such as inaccurate rapid fire, for their sales appeal. Not only does the P3 embrace a quantum leap in material technology, but it benefits from functional evolution of valves and other key internal features. It looks and feels like solid German quality, and it is!
Pulling back what appears to be the hammer allows the top frame to be swung up as a charging lever. Just swing it forward, insert the pellet, and then swing it back to compress the air charge-an easy, natural action. An automatic safety prevents "beartrap" closing or accidental discharge. This top frame contains the beautifully rifled steel barrel and both the front and rear sights, all as a single rigid unit. The sights cannot get out of alignment with each other during cocking. As a single stroke pneumatic, the P3 has absolutely no recoil or spring jump. A functional, built-in muzzle brake prevents any tendency for muzzle flip. Couple this steadiness with its wonderfully crisp trigger and you have a pistol which just naturally shoots accurately offhand - not just from special testing clamps. Practice, very quietly and inexpensively, with the P3 until you can place all your shots well and you will be able to shoot even more accurately with a good firearm pistol. The P3 is a practical pistol, but it is just a joy to shoot! |

| The Baikal Model IZH-46M
International Competition Air Pistol is made in the Baikal /
Izhevsky
works, one of Russia's premier firearms manufacturers. These premium
match pistols are designed to provide years of service — they even
include an extra set of piston and breech seals. The Baikal Model
IZH-46M includes many features found on the world's top competition
air pistols.
